NEWS
Steigender RAM Verbrauch normal?
-
Wird zwar nichts zu deinem Problem bringen, aber heb nodejs auf Version 16
Gut, da hatte ich die Vermutung, dass es eher mit skripten zusammenhängt, aber die Empfehlung ging da schon zu nodejs16.
-
@thomas-braun Auch da aufpassen, 16.16 ist auch kaputt. 16.17 könnte ok sein: https://github.com/AlCalzone/ioBroker.zwave2/issues/919#issuecomment-1227290060
-
Da 16.17.0 die aktuelle stabile Version ist und man ja immer diese fährt...
Kein Problem...
Die 18 hat übrigens ein Problem mit dem Netzwerk, da steigen regelmäßig Adapter aus. Nur so als Vorwarnung, falls jemand sein Heil in node18 suchen sollte...
-
@thomas-braun sagte in Steigender RAM Verbrauch normal?:
Die 18 hat übrigens ein Problem mit dem Netzwerk, da steigen regelmäßig Adapter aus. Nur so als Vorwarnung, falls jemand sein Heil in node18 suchen sollte...
Wobei man da nochmal rausfinden muss was los ist und was es genau ist
-
Ich vermute da was aus der Richtung 'crypto' / Passwortverschlüsselung.
Diverse Adapter werden ausgeloggt, kommen dann aber wieder in die cloud des Herstellers, um dann ein paar Minuten später wieder rauszufliegen.
Besonders beim tado-Adapter und nodejs 18.8.0 fällt mir das auf, bis nodejs 18.7.0 war das i.O.Ich warte mal ein nodejs-Update auf 18.9.0 ab, bevor ich da genauer schaue.
Ist aber auch hier komplett OT...
-
@zeron850 sagte in Steigender RAM Verbrauch normal?:
Der Odroid C4 hat allerdings nur 3,6 bzw. 3,7 GB RAM. Von daher wird das mit den 4 GB schwierig.
der c4 hat -oh wunder- 4 GB RAM.
davon aber etwas für die Grafik abgezwackt.Damit müsste ioBroker ausreichend gut bestückt sein.
welches OS nutzst du?
Warum kein Armbian? -
@dp20eic
@HomoranDanke für die Tipps und ich habe jetzt mal den RAM für der User iobroker auf 2G eingeschränkt. Mal sehen ob dieser sich dran hält
Einen Neustart muss ich aber nicht machen?
Ich nutze als OS Dietpi und das System ist sehr einfach zu handhaben und läuft extrem stabil bei mir. Armbian habe ich zwar mal gehört aber bislang keine Erfahrung damit gesammelt. Dietpi ist für Einsteiger wie mich sehr einfach in der Handhabung.
-
Hast du denn in dem Zug auch nodejs auf 16 gehoben? Da scheint es ja auch evtl. Issues mit deiner Version 14 zu geben.
-
Nein aktuell noch nicht. Ich möchte da noch warten. Wenn ich den User auf 2G einschränke müsste das doch auch in der Admin angezeigt werden? Dort stehen nach wie vor die vollen 3.7G
-
@zeron850 sagte in Steigender RAM Verbrauch normal?:
Dort stehen nach wie vor die vollen 3.7G
Das ist der im Gesamtsystem vorhandene Arbeitsspeicher.
Ich weiß auch nicht was du dir von der Beschränkung auf 2 GB versprichst. Dann geht dir halt bei 2 GB auf dem sog. Heap die Luft aus. -
Ich bin offen für alle Lösungen. Wie löse ich das Problem dann?
-
@zeron850 sagte in Steigender RAM Verbrauch normal?:
Wie löse ich das Problem dann?
Nodejs 16.17.0 installieren?
-
Werde ich dann am Wochenende in Ruhe machen. Zumindest weiß ich jetzt das die RAM Beschränkung nicht funktioniert. ioBroker nimmt weiterhin was es braucht....
-
@zeron850 sagte in Steigender RAM Verbrauch normal?:
ioBroker nimmt weiterhin was es braucht....
Das dürfte auch 'pro Prozess' gelten, nicht für node insgesamt.
-
Gut möglich... 2G pro Prozess, soweit wird er kaum kommen....
-
Hallo Zusammen,
ich bin heute Abend dazugekommen den Umstieg auf Node JS 16.17 durchzuführen. Was ich nun leider feststellen muss das der RAM Verbrauch mit der 16er Version noch deutlich schneller ansteigt als mit der 14.20.
Dies halt leider nicht funktioniert.... Der Javascript Adapter ist am stabilsten und verbraucht konstant 171 MB... Ich bin sicher das es an keinem Skript liegt...
-
@zeron850 sagte in Steigender RAM Verbrauch normal?:
Die 1,1G verfügbar sind bis heute Nacht aufgebraucht.
zeig doch so etwas mal.
in diesem Screenshot ist free=available.Das ist nicht normal.
am besten auch ein paar Zeilen unter dem Header, sortiert nach MEM.
-
Gerne anbei ein Screenshot des htop sortiert nach MEM und einen meiner Aufzeichnung....
Habe ihn jetzt nochmal neu gestartet... Ich lasse ihn jetzt mal über Nacht laufen. Mal sehen was morgen der RAM Stand ist um diese Zeit...
-
@zeron850 sagte in Steigender RAM Verbrauch normal?:
sortiert nach MEM
sicher?
erkenne ich leider nicht.dafür fehlt der Header jetzt ganz.
rauskopieren im Screenshot ist auch ziemlich mühsam.
ziemlich weit unten scheint noch etwas mit unglaublichen 635MB zu stehen.
sae oder so.Was frisst das denn an Speicher!!
java??wofür ist das?
-
@homoran sagte in Steigender RAM Verbrauch normal?:
ziemlich weit unten scheint noch etwas mit unglaublichen 635MB zu stehen.
sae oder so.Das dürfte von dem deCONZ kommen. Der läuft soweit ich weiß mit Java.